On 2019/02/18 2:34, Katsuhiro Suzuki wrote:
> This patch adds HDMI sound (I2S0) node for rock64.
>
> After apply this patch, UART2 will fail to allocate DMA resources
> but UART driver can work fine without DMA.
>
> This error is related to the DMAC of rk3328 (pl330 or compatible).
> DMAC connected to 16 DMA sources. Each sources have ID number that is
> called 'Req number' in rk3328 TRM. Currently total 7 sources has been
> activated as follows:
>
> | Req number | Source | Required |
> | | | channels |
> |------------+--------+-----------|
> | 14, 15 | I2S1 | 2ch |
> | 6, 7 | UART2 | 2ch |
> | 10 | SPDIF | 1ch |
> | 8, 9 | SPI0 | 2ch |
> |------------+--------+-----------|
> | | Total | 7ch |
>
> HDMI audio needs to activate new source I2S0 (Req number 11 and 12).
> I2S0 can work concurrently with other sources, but rk3328 DMAC can
> use max 8 channels at same time. If I2S0 is simply activated by this
> patch, required DMAC channels will be 9. So last one (UART2) cannot
> allocate the DMA resources.
>
> Virt-dma mechanism for pl0330 DMAC driver is needed to fix this
> problem.
